Top 5 Fish Games on iOS in Bahrain: Q2 2024 Performance
In Q2 2024, Fishdom led the Fish Games category in Bahrain with notable weekly downloads and revenue.
During the second quarter of 2024, the Fish Games category on iOS in Bahrain saw varied performance among the top five applications. The data, sourced from Sensor Tower, provides insights into the weekly downloads and revenue trends for these popular games.
Fishdom from Playrix showed consistent performance throughout the quarter. Weekly revenue fluctuated slightly but remained strong, peaking at approximately $986 in the last week of May. Downloads experienced significant growth towards the end of the quarter, rising from 71 in early April to 202 in the final week of June.
Fishdom Solitaire, another title by Playrix, had a more modest revenue stream. Despite starting the quarter with a weekly revenue of $120, it saw a notable dip mid-quarter, reaching as low as $21 in mid-June before recovering to $63 by the end of the quarter. Downloads for this game remained minimal, with only a few instances recorded in May and June.
Hungry Shark World by Ubisoft displayed mixed results. The game’s revenue saw a significant peak of $76 in mid-June, despite some lower weeks, such as $10 in mid-May. Downloads also varied, with a notable increase towards the end of the quarter, reaching 121 in the week of June 17.
Hungry Shark Evolution, another Ubisoft title, maintained a steady weekly revenue, peaking at $60 in early April and $41 in the last week of June. Downloads showed a consistent upward trend, especially in June, where they rose from 64 in the first week to 105 in the second week of the month.
Lastly, Undersea Solitaire Tripeaks by Plarium Global Ltd had the least variation in performance. The game’s revenue remained low, fluctuating between $2 and $6 throughout the quarter. No significant download activity was recorded for this game during this period.
